Question 4: What are the recommended care instructions to preserve the design and color of the shirt?
Proper care is essential to maintain the vibrancy of the design and prevent premature fading. Machine washing inside-out in cold water, using a mild detergent, and avoiding harsh chemicals such as bleach are generally recommended. Tumble drying on low heat or air drying is preferable to prevent shrinkage and damage to the printed image. Following these care instructions will significantly extend the shirt’s lifespan and preserve its aesthetic appeal.
